/// Extracts the target name and the module path (without the target name) from a full module path string.
///
/// # Arguments
///
/// * `base_string`: a full module path string (ex: bp3d_logger::util::extract_target_module).
///
/// returns: (&str, &str)
pub fn extract_target_module(base_string: &str) -> (&str, &str) {
let target = base_string
.find("::")
.map(|v| &base_string[..v])
.unwrap_or(base_string);
let module = base_string.find("::").map(|v| &base_string[(v + 2)..]);
(target, module.unwrap_or("main"))
}
/// The context of a log message.
#[derive(Clone, Copy, Debug)]
pub struct Location {
module_path: &'static str,
file: &'static str,
line: u32,
}
impl Location {
/// Creates a new instance of a log message location.
///
/// This function is const to let the caller store location structures in statics.
///
/// # Arguments
///
/// * `module_path`: the module path obtained from the [module_path](module_path) macro.
/// * `file`: the source file obtained from the [file](file) macro.
/// * `line`: the line number in the source file obtained from the [line](line) macro.
///
/// returns: Metadata
pub const fn new(module_path: &'static str, file: &'static str, line: u32) -> Self {
Self {
module_path,
file,
line,
}
}
/// The module path which issued this log message.
pub fn module_path(&self) -> &'static str {
self.module_path
}
/// The source file which issued this log message.
pub fn file(&self) -> &'static str {
self.file
}
/// The line in the source file which issued this log message.
pub fn line(&self) -> u32 {
self.line
}
/// Extracts the target name and the module name from the module path.
pub fn get_target_module(&self) -> (&'static str, &'static str) {
extract_target_module(self.module_path)
}
}
/// Generate a [Location](crate::Location) structure.
#[macro_export]
macro_rules! location {
() => {
$crate::util::Location::new(module_path!(), file!(), line!())
};
}
